Job Description

Support & Software Consultant: Provide technical support to hotel customers, leveraging industry experience and IT knowledge, while fostering effective communication and collaboration within the team.

Welcome to Planet, where hospitality expertise merges seamlessly with cutting-edge technology. As a global leader in hotel management software and a world-class player in the payments industry, we are dedicated to delivering efficient solutions that enhance our customers' operations. Our suite of Property Management System (PMS) brands includes Hotsoft from Hoist, Protel On-Prem, Protel Cloud (formerly Protel Air) - all designed to meet the diverse needs of the hospitality industry.

At Planet, our cloud and on-premise solutions have been at the forefront of revolutionizing the hospitality industry for over 25 years. Whether it's enhancing front office operations, optimizing online sales, or providing role-specific apps for hotel managers and their teams, we continually raise the bar for excellence.

As a Support & Software Consultant at Planet, you'll play a crucial role in assisting our customers over the phone, chat or via email. With the skills we provide through comprehensive training, you'll troubleshoot issues efficiently and guide our customers on maximizing their software usage. Beyond problem-solving, your responsibilities will extend to consulting with, installing, and training our new hotel customers.

We prioritize candidates with a background in the hotel industry, ensuring familiarity with its processes and procedures. An innate curiosity for IT technology is essential. Don't worry - we'll equip you with the necessary technical knowledge. Our support team comprises individuals with roots in the hotel industry, all of whom have undergone tailored training.

Key responsibilities:

  • Provide technical support in one of our many products, leveraging the hotel industry experience that you bring with you and the IT knowledge that we train you in.
  • Take ownership of customer inquiries, making decisions independently and assuming responsibility.
  • Communicate articulately and maintain a friendly tone, even in high-pressure situations.
  • Uphold a customer-centric approach, consistently striving to deliver exceptional service.
  • Foster effective communication and collaboration within the team.
  • Willingness to travel from time to time, if needed.
  • Be flexible with your schedule, including availability for shifts and weekends, as hotels operate 24/7.

Key qualifications:

  • A successfully completed apprenticeship in the field of hospitality and/or the IT industry or other educational equivalent.
  • At least one year of professional experience in front office / reservations.
  • Excellent spoken and written French and English language. German is also a distinct advantage.
